A look at Dr. Freidberg’s education and training
Nick Freidberg MD completed his undergraduate studies at The University of Texas at Austin. This Austin urologist then earned his medical degree from UT Health – San Antonio. He went on to complete his general surgery internship and residency in urological surgery at George Washington University in Washington, D.C. Dr. Freidberg then completed his urologic surgery training in Lexington, Kentucky by completing a combined robotic surgery and endourology fellowship.
Nick Freidberg MD diagnoses and treats many urology conditions
As a highly trained Austin urologist and surgeon, Dr. Freidberg has clinical and research interests in several areas of urology, including general urology and the following:
- Genitourinary cancers, including bladder, prostate, adrenal, kidney, ureter and testicular
- Kidney stone disease, including complex stone management
- Minimally invasive (robotic/laparoscopic) surgery
- Open surgery and scrotal surgery
- Advanced BPH treatments, including TURP, Greenlight PVP, UroLift, Aquablation and robotic simple prostatectomy
